Since its release in 1995, Asahi Kuronama has become Japan's favourite dark beer with its rich aroma and subtle sweetness. It is made from three types of dark roasted malt that each gives a different characteristic flavour according to how it is roasted and toasted. 'Dark malt' produces the distinct fragrance of dark beer. 'Crystal malt' imparts a delicate sweetness, and 'Munich malt' adds a fullness of taste. The exquisite blend of these three types of malt maximizes the goodness of each and creates Asahi Kuronama's distinct richness and smoothness.

The world's first beer that naturally forms a head when you remove the lid - each Nama Jokki can has a precision-engineered uneven surface that activates natural bubbles when opened at the ideal temperature between four and eight degrees. The fully removable lid creates a smooth edge so you can enjoy straight from the can. With its robust blend of fruit and chocolate flavours and bitter hop notes, it's everything a stout should be. An all malt brew that's naturally conditioned in the bottle, Coopers Best Extra Stout's unique rich, dark texture comes from our liberal use of specially roasted black malt. No additives.
